Prior to being familiar with the theory of HPLC, very first, we must understand about chromatography. Chromatography is an analytical process of separating components in a mix. To initiate the process, a mix of unfamiliar components is dissolved in a substance known as cellular period, which carries it via a sound second material known as the stationary section. This mixture of unknown factors travels in the stationary section at variable speed, producing them to different from each other.

Wherever Kc, the distribution constant, is the ratio in the activity of compound A during the stationary stage and activity of compound A inside the mobile section. In the majority of separations, which comprise low concentrations of your species to be separated, the activity of A in Just about every is close to equivalent on the concentration of A in that point out. The distribution regular indicates the amount of time that compound A spends adsorbed to your stationary period since the opposed to the length of time A spends solvated because of the cellular stage.
